body {
	font-family:	Arial;
	font-size:	12px;
}

.box-main {
	width:		800px;
}

.box-header-info {
	margin:		0px 10px; /*	top-bottom left-right	*/
	float:		left;
	width:		780px;
}

.box-top {
	height:		40px;
}

.box-top-info {
	/*
	margin-left: 10px;
	margin-right: 10px;
	*/
	margin:		0px 10px; /*	top-bottom left-right	*/
	float:		left;
	width:		780px;
	border-bottom:	solid 2px #0789C5;
}

.box-top-info-left {
	float:		left;
	padding:	8px;
	padding-top:	12px;
}

.box-top-info-right {
	float:		right;
	padding-top:	15px;
}

.box-center {
	float:		left;
	/*
	margin-top: 10px;
	margin-bottom: 10px;
	*/
	margin:		10px 0; /*	top-bottom left-right	*/
}

.box-center-left {
	float:		left;
	width:		210px;
}

.box-center-left-info {
	padding:	10px;
	padding-top:	15px;
}

.box-center-middle {
	float:		left;
	width:		295px;
}

.box-center-right {
	float:		left;
	width:		295px;
}

.box-bottom	 {
	float:		left;
}

.box-bottom-info {
	width:		780px;
	height:		40px;
	/*
	margin-left:	10px;
	margin-right:	10px;
	*/
	margin:		0px 10px; /*	top-bottom left-right	*/
	padding-top:	10px;

	border-top:	solid 1px #0789C5;
	text-align:	center;
}

.box-info {
	border-left:	solid 1px #0789C5;
}

.box-info-top {
	height:		315px;
	margin:		0px 10px -15px;
	/*
	margin-left:	10px;
	margin-right:	10px;
	margin-bottom: -15px;
	*/
	padding:	40px 5px 0px;
	/*
	padding-top: 40px;
	padding-bottom: 0px;
	*/
}
.box-info-bottom {
	height:		90px;
	margin:		0px 10px;
	/*
	margin-left: 10px;
	margin-right: 10px;		
	*/
	padding:	5px;
	padding-top:	15px;
	border-top:	solid 1px #0789C5;
}

.box-center-middle .box-info-top {
	background-image:	url(../images/header_jobseeker.gif);
	background-position:	left top; 
	background-repeat:	no-repeat;
}

.box-center-right .box-info-top {
	background-image:	url(../images/header_employer.gif);
	background-position:	left top; 
	background-repeat:	no-repeat;
}

.title {
	font-weight:	bold;
	color:		#0789C5;
}

img.button {
	margin:		10px 0px;
	/*
	margin-top: 10px;
	margin-bottom: 10px;
	*/
}

.big-text {
	font-size:	18px;
}

.small-text {
	font-size:	11px;
}
